This collaboration is a fantastic example of the style, the dark brown pour loaded with enticing notes of caramel malt, earthy peat, brown sugar and some red plum-skin nuances. Balanced and drinkable despite the higher alcohol, which only truly makes itself known on the slightly warming peppery finish. The hops give a good lift to the mouthfeel and a slight dryness…
